What Is a Lincoln Lease-End Inspection?
A Lincoln lease-end inspection reviews the condition of your vehicle before it's returned. LAFS arranges this through Manheim Mobile Inspections, also known as Alliance Inspection Management (AiM). Appointments can typically take place at your home, your workplace, or a local Lincoln retailer.
Plan to schedule your complimentary inspection somewhere in the last 45 to 60 days before your lease ends. Appointments can typically be self-scheduled online or by phone.
Understanding Wear and Use Guidelines
Some wear is expected on a leased vehicle. Lincoln's Wear and Use guidelines outline what's considered normal versus chargeable. As a general guide, more than three scratches or dents longer than 4 inches per panel, more than 15 paint chips per panel, or tire tread under 1/8 inch fall under excess wear and use, along with things like sidewall damage and interior stains larger than a half inch. Reviewing your guidelines ahead of time can help you know what to expect at inspection.
After Your Inspection: Repairs and Your Final Statement
If your inspection turns up items you'd rather handle yourself, our Collision Center and factory-trained technicians can take care of it using genuine Lincoln parts, and it's worth keeping your repair receipts on hand for your return appointment. Once your lease is complete, LAFS mails or posts a final statement to your Account Manager reflecting any mileage or wear and use charges. If you didn't renew into a new Lincoln or Ford through LAFS, this statement may also include a disposition fee, if one is disclosed on your Lease Agreement.
How to Prepare for Your Lincoln Lease Turn-In
Before your lease-end inspection, it helps to walk around your Lincoln and check for anything that may need attention.
- Exterior dents, scratches, or paint damage
- Windshield chips or cracked glass
- Tire tread depth and overall tire condition
- Wheel scratches or gouges
- Interior stains, tears, or burn marks
- Mileage compared to your Lease Agreement, which can result in an excess mileage fee if you're over your allotted miles
- Missing keys, fobs, manuals, mats, or accessories
- A master reset of your SYNC®/Navigation system
- The Lincoln Mobile Power Cord, if you're returning a Corsair Grand Touring plug-in hybrid

Your Lincoln Lease-End Options
When your Lincoln lease is ending, LAFS gives you three main paths, depending on your Lease Agreement and current situation.
Return Your Lease
Ready to turn in your current Lincoln? Contact our team to schedule your appointment. Need more time instead? Ask our finance team about lease extension eligibility before you commit to a return date.
Get a New Lincoln
Move into a new Lincoln. Browse current inventory and current specials. Ask about current disposition fee and wear and use waivers when you renew through LAFS.
Purchase Your Lincoln
Love your current vehicle? Purchasing it at lease end means no inspection, no wear and use charges, and no excess mileage charges. Apply for financing to get started on a purchase price.
